For decades, satellite internet suffered from a host of issues, including high latency, limited bandwidth, and expensive infrastructure. However, recent advancements in low Earth orbit (LEO) satellite technology have dramatically changed the game. Companies are now launching constellations of small satellites that orbit closer to the Earth, reducing latency and increasing data transfer speeds.
